TANCOPANICAN CHRONICLE, 1830-1834.
Crowninshield, Louise Dup. and Pierre S. Dupont (editors)
7 volumes.
Reprints of the guest books kept at Eleutherian Mills with indices to names, etc. The 16 page preface / forward volume is lacking from this set. Soiling to box.

HISTORY OF PRINTING IN COLONIAL MARYLAND 1686-1776.
by Wroth, Lawrence C.
One of 125 numbered copies printed on Rives hand-made paper and signed by Wroth and three others associated with the project. Contains a number of full page plates. The first 147 pages give a history of printing in Maryland; the rest of the book contains full bibliographical descriptions of Maryland imprints printed during the colonial period. With a bookplate indicating that this copy was presented as a gift to George H. Carter, Public Printer. Slightly rubbed.
